Explore the Possibilities: Styles and Finishes

The world of chandeliers is vast and varied, offering a design for every taste and aesthetic. Here are a few popular styles to consider:

  • Modern: Sleek lines, minimalist designs, and often featuring LED technology for energy efficiency. A modern hallway island chandelier can add a touch of sophistication to any space.

  • Farmhouse: Rustic charm with wrought iron accents, often paired with Edison bulbs for a vintage feel. This is a great option for those seeking a warm and inviting atmosphere.

  • Crystal: Timeless elegance and sparkling brilliance, perfect for adding a touch of glamour to your home. A crystal chandelier is a classic choice for those who appreciate luxury and sophistication.

  • Transitional: A blend of traditional and modern elements, offering a versatile option that complements a wide range of décor styles.

Beyond style, the finish of your light fixture can also have a significant impact on the overall look and feel of your space. Popular finishes include:

  • Brushed Nickel: A classic and versatile finish that complements a variety of color schemes. A brushed nickel hallway island chandelier is a popular choice for its understated elegance.

  • Black: A bold and modern choice that adds a touch of drama to any room. A black hallway island chandelier is a great way to make a statement.

  • Gold: A luxurious and opulent finish that adds warmth and sophistication to your home. A gold hallway island chandelier is a perfect way to add a touch of glamour.

Practical Considerations: Size, Height, and Functionality

Before you make a purchase, it's important to consider the practical aspects of installing a light fixture. Here are a few key factors to keep in mind:

  • Size: Choose a light fixture that is proportionate to the size of your hallway or kitchen island. A small light fixture can get lost in a large space, while a large light fixture can overwhelm a smaller area. Consider a small hallway island chandelier if space is limited, or a large hallway island chandelier for a grander statement.

  • Height: Ensure that the light fixture is hung at the proper height to avoid obstructing views or creating a safety hazard. For vaulted or high ceilings, consider a light fixture specifically designed for those spaces. An adjustable height hallway island chandelier can provide flexibility in installation.

  • Functionality: Determine the primary purpose of the light fixture. If you need ample light for tasks such as cooking or reading, choose a light fixture with sufficient light output. Consider an LED hallway island chandelier for energy efficiency or a dimmable hallway island chandelier to control the level of brightness. If you want to enhance the ambience, consider a light fixture with fabric shades or Edison bulbs.

Commonly Asked Questions About Hallway Island Chandelier

Q: What makes an island chandelier different from other types of chandeliers?

A: Island chandeliers are specifically designed to provide focused and beautiful illumination over kitchen islands, dining tables, or other rectangular spaces. Their elongated shape and thoughtful design ensure even light distribution across the entire surface, creating a welcoming and functional ambiance.

Q: What kind of design styles do island chandeliers come in?

A: Island chandeliers are available in a vast array of design styles, from modern and minimalist to rustic and traditional, ensuring you'll find the perfect complement to your existing décor. They offer a fantastic opportunity to enhance the overall aesthetic of your kitchen or dining area.

Q: What type of bulbs work best in an island chandelier?

A: The best type of bulbs depend on the specific island chandelier model and the ambiance you're trying to create! Many island chandeliers are compatible with energy-efficient LED bulbs, which offer long-lasting and beautiful illumination. Consider the bulb's color temperature to achieve the desired warm or cool lighting effect.

Q: Is it difficult to install an island chandelier?

A: Installing an island chandelier typically involves electrical connections and proper mounting. To ensure safety and optimal performance, we highly recommend consulting with a qualified and licensed electrician for professional installation.
